Is Miami Township, Montgomery County, OH Safe?
Miami Township, Montgomery County, OH has average safety with a score of 73/100, placing it around the middle of US cities. The city ranks #6,041 out of 8,874 US cities in our safety database.
The violent crime rate of 182.6 per 100k is 52% below the national average (380 per 100k). Violent crime accounts for 8% of all reported incidents.
Most residents feel safe day-to-day. Standard urban precautions are recommended.
